Table of Contents:
- Building the historical enterprise, 1880 to 1910. Establishing a framework for "scientific" history scholarship ; Developing the tools and materials of history research ; Defining a profession of history teaching
- Cracks appear in the edifice of history, 1911 to 1925. Seeking refuge in professionalized scholarship ; Placing the tools and materials of research in "other hands" ; History teaching finds its own voice
- Scattering the historical enterprise, 1926 to 1940. The crisis of the "research men" ; Handing tools and materials over to others ; Teaching goes its own way, 1925-1940.
